Transaction 274c63cc360d0b6440e86197360c13580acf648992265753428e5da9468df411

3 Input
2 Outputs
  • 274c63cc360d0b6440e86197360c13580acf648992265753428e5da9468df411:0
  • value  25000000
    address  39PeC3NRWs1BbcPibecuirYvQfCRUeAYyR
  • 274c63cc360d0b6440e86197360c13580acf648992265753428e5da9468df411:1
  • value  1000189
    address  15XqcNtfRSBmtwWjmBLBRU23Shx5pypYar